> I'm trying to setup an Nginx proxy that redirect all requests from > provider.domain.com to proxy.appname.com/provider (where proxy.appname.com > is the server_name in nginx server) > > The configuration of server and location blocks are fine, but the issue is > that the provider.domain.com is automatically redirecting to > provider.domain.com/broker/login.php (when I hit the provider.domain.com > from the browser, it's automatically taking me to > provider.domain.com/broker/login.php) which give an error with nginx proxy > when trying to redirect to a non-existent page (proxy.appname.com/provider > redirect to proxy.appname.com/broker/login.php -> which does not exist) > > > location /provider/ { > proxy_pass https://provider.domain.com; > proxy_set_header X-Forwarded-Host $server_name; > proxy_set_header Host proxy.appname.com; > error_log /var/log/nginx/appname.log debug; > proxy_set_header Accept-Encoding text/xml; > } > > > > So, how can I set this to redirect all requests from provider.domain.com > automatically to > proxy.appname.com/provider (we don't need to mention the full path in > proxy_pass; as we have multiple endpoints to hi from the provider link such > as api…etc.) Check how redirects are returned, and configure proxy_redirect appropriately. See http://nginx.org/r/proxy_redirect for details. -- Maxim Dounin http://mdounin.ru/ _______________________________________________ nginx mailing list nginx@nginx.org http://mailman.nginx.org/mailman/listinfo/nginx
